The China data center cooling market size was valued at USD 892.30 Billion in 2022 and is likely to reach USD 3.339 Billion by 2031, expanding at a CAGR of 16% during 2023 – 2031.The growth of the market is attributed to increasing number of large businesses are planning to increase their data centers to ensure reliability and stability of data services.
Data center cooling guarantees that the data center receives the required cooling and ventilation to maintain all devices and equipment within the specified temperature range. The equipment, tools, techniques, and processes used to maintain an appropriate operating temperature within a data center facility are referred to as data center cooling.

China Data Center Cooling Market Segment Insights
Liquid cooling systems segment is expected to grow at a rapid pace
Based on solutions, the China data center cooling market is divided into air conditioners/handlers, row/rack/door/overhead cooling systems, chillers, liquid cooling systems, economizer systems. The liquid cooling systems segment is expected to grow at a rapid pace during the forecast period owing to rising preference among large enterprises. Moreover, high-volume manufacturing of liquid coolers for cooling is expected to gain significant traction in the market.

Installation & deployment segment is projected to expand at a considerable CAGR
On the basis of services, the market is segregated into installation & deployment, consulting, support, and maintenance services. The installation & deployment segment is projected to expand at a considerable CAGR during the forecast period due to increasing number of small and medium businesses (SMEs) and big companies utilize the installation and deployment programs to assist companies place energy-efficient data center cooling in a cost-effective way.
Information technology segment is anticipated to account for a significant market share
In terms of end-user verticals, the market is divided into information technology, BFSI, telecommunication, healthcare, government, and others. The information technology segment is estimated to account for a significant market share during the forecast period owing to widening scope of IT services and growing digitalization. However, the BFSI segment is expected to exhibit a substantial CAGR during the forecast period.

Competitive Landscape
The cooling market for data centers in China is fairly fragmented. industry players are seeking strategic alliances and collaborations to increase their market share.
Key players competing in the China data center cooling market are Schneider Electric SE; STULZ GMBH;Vertiv Co.; Daikin Industries Ltd; and Trane Inc.
